The Next Mile of the European Civil Society Infrastructure
The European Roma Information Office (ERIO) is a participating member of the project The Next Mile of the European Civil Society Infrastructure, coordinated by the Open Society Institute in Bulgaria. The aim of the project is to strengthen the role of the third sector in Bulgaria and Romania in improving the social environment by utilising the institutional capacities of Civil Society organizations (CSOs) and stimulating new forms of cooperation.
The specific objectives of the project are to ensure equal treatment and maintain the human dignity of the target communities with which Bulgarian and Romanian CSOs work, and to widen (within Bulgaria and Romania) the influence of best practices used by EU-CSOs and CSOs networks. The project has two target groups: the first comprises CSOs active in the social sphere (service providers, advocacy, research and resource centres working for the interest of vulnerable groups, policy-makers, etc.), and the second group consists of different categories of vulnerable groups (minorities, disabled persons, children and young people with specific social problems). Project activities will then cover CSOs that provide services to Roma and other vulnerable groups in which Roma are overrepresented.
ERIO is contributing to the elaboration of methodological and information material in this field. The objective of this activity is to gather information on European social policy networks and their methods of operation at the European, national and local levels in EU Member States, thus developing a major methodological tool that will be useful in the work of NGO service providers in Bulgaria and Romania and help them to access other European networks.
